## Deployment

Quick note for whoever's doing the security pass: the Mossgrain component library ships as versioned bundles, not a floating "latest" — we learned that lesson the hard way. Each release is built in the Hollowgate CI pool, signed, and pushed to our internal registry where consumers pin an exact version. Rollbacks are just a pin change, so there's no mutable state to worry about. The one thing worth scrutinizing is how the publish job authenticates and which registry it targets, which is all driven by the config shown here.

service settings:
PRAIX_LOG_LEVEL=error
PRAIX_METRICS_HOST=metrics.praix.qorvelcorp.corp
PRAIX_POOL_SIZE=16

ALERT: Orphan Sweeper Stalled (Driftvale)

The orphaned-resource sweeper has not completed a pass in 6 hours. Unreclaimed volumes are accumulating and storage quota is at 91%. Likely cause: lock contention with the nightly snapshot job. Do not ship the pending release until the sweeper clears backlog; new deploys create more orphans than it can absorb. Rollback is not required. Escalate sweeper ownership questions to the address below.

escalation mailbox, hadug-bajog: sormir@norvalabs.internal

Subject: Quickstore 4.2 — bloom filter now fronts the KV layer

Plugin authors: starting with this release, Quickstore places a bloom filter ahead of the key-value store. Negative lookups return faster; false positives fall through safely. No API changes are required on your side. Verify your plugin against the staging build referenced below.

session token of fahif-tadup = htk3_9c7

Minutes — Management Meeting, Brindale Software

Attendees: regional leadership; apologies from T. Okafor.

The group approved the move to annual billing for all Clearway subscriptions from next quarter. Branch managers will brief account teams and flag at-risk monthly customers. Finance confirmed invoicing templates are ready. Discounts for early conversion were agreed in principle. One further item was discussed under restriction, and is recorded below.

confidential, kajof-tahof: The pricing group signed off on a budget of $491.8 million for Project Casvan.